Leith felt curious not only about Towhee's language, but of its conception as well. He couldn't imagine inventing movements that could accurately depict all of the words that his mouth could make- but according to the Chief, she seemed to have figured it out. He could only imagine how much of a relief it must be for her to have others learn how to speak with her- language helped to liberate feelings and ideas. 

"Ah," He said, clicking his tongue at his own error. He followed the man until the peak came into view, naturally drawing his eye to its tall, jagged form. A smaller formation of mountains seemed to be the place where Kukutux lived- easy enough to spot if you had the proper vantage point. Leith gazed up at the sky for a moment, calculating the placement of the sun and the rough time of day so that he could get a good enough bearing on what direction the two packs lay in. A third was mentioned, one next to the coast. He sniffed and nodded, taking in all the directions with ease. "I'll have to pay them all a visit in time," He said. His thoughts strayed first between Moonglow and Moonspear, knowing that they might have someone who could trade knowledge with him. 

He was relieved to hear that the conflict involving Ariadne might not sour their relationships with the other packs, though his brow lifted when Dutch touted himself as a charming man. The statement surprised him so suddenly that he laughed. "She must," He agreed, giving the man an appraising look for a moment. There was plenty to appreciate about his looks in general, and while his earliest (and foggiest) memories of Dutch painted the picture of a relatively serious man, he learned quickly that he was not without a good sense of humour as well. 

He rolled a shoulder, as if to shrug off any bias. He'd only met Ariadne twice, and she had seemed fine- but he was willing to both forgive her for her abandonment, figuring that there must be some reason he must not yet know. "We'll be fine here as we are anyhow, I'm sure," He said. "Who else have we got in the pack? Any other specialists?"
